They also say, ‘What? When we are turned to bones and dust, shall we really be raised up in a new act of creation?’ Say, ‘[Yes] even if you were [as hard as] stone, or iron, or any other substance you think hard to bring to life.’ Then they will say, ‘Who will bring us back?’ Say, ‘The One who created you the first time.’ Then they will shake their heads at you and say, ‘When will that be?’ Say, ‘It may well be very soon.’ (Al Quran 17:49-51)

When asked who among the believers is the wisest, the Prophet (ﷺ) replied: “Those who remember death most often and are best in preparing for it. Those are the wisest.” (Source: Sunan Ibn Majah 4259)
